6-string guitarists do this all the time, tuning 6=D frequently and 5=G occasionally. With a 7-10 string, there are even more possibilities. The bass note...

... On the Ramirez 10-string, the fretboard is tapered thinner so that the lower strings have more room to vibrate. Those low strings are very floopy, and ...
